Demographics: Client Initials: PM Birth Date: 10/23/1955 Age: 65 Gender: F Birth Place/Country of Origin Hermitage, PA, USA Race/Ethnic Origin: Caucasian Marital Status: Widowed Employer: Retired Occupation: N/A 2. Sources and Reliability: 3. Chief Complaint/Reason for seeking care: Intermittent chest pain 4. History of present illness: Patient states “I have been outside walking a few times this month and I have noticed that my chest gets tight and it’s hard to breathe when I do so. I have tried to stop smoking because I know it’s bad for me, but I get so anxious that I can’t stop. I get worried because I had a heart attack a few years ago.” PM reports that she takes a baby aspirin every day and takes her Lisinopril regularly. She does not take any other medications. 5. Past Health History: Patient has a history of a heart attack in 2017, she has two cardiac stents. She has a history of hypertension and takes Lisinopril for it. She also has a history of obesity but after her heart attack she reports that she lost 50lbs. She reports that she was diagnosed with diabetes 15 years ago but she does not take the medication she is supposed to anymore because she is controlling it “With her diet.” At her last doctors appointment though they found her BG to be high. She currently smokes half a pack of cigarettes a day. She had one C-section and a hysterectomy. Last Physical exam date 08/22/2019 Last dental exam July 2019 Last Vision exam unknown, pt states she had her vision checked at her last physical. Last hearing screen 08/22/2019- pt states her hearing was checked at her family doctor as well. Last ECG 12/14/2019 Last TB skin test unknown Last Chest X-Ray 12/14/2019 Childhood History: Chicken pox Accidents: Car accident in 2014, totaled her car but no injuries Serious or chronic illnesses/ Medical Problems Condition Onset Resolution/Treatment      Acute MI      While she was cooking dinner in 2017      Pt given Nitro and Aspirin in ER and had cardiac stents placed.      Hypertention      unk      Takes 20mg of Lisinopril daily      Diabetes Type 2      age 50      Pt prescribed metformin but does not take it
